> Currently, the `SetLocalXXX` minimal support for virtual threads is defined for a virtual threads suspended at a breakpoint or single step event. This enhancement is to extend to virtual threads suspended any event. This make `SetLocalXXX` spec consistent with specs of the `StopThread`, `PopFrame` and `ForceEarlyReturnXXX`.
>
> It does not look that any implementation update is needed as it is already supporting any suspended and mounted virtual thread which includes suspended at an event cases.
>
> The CSR (already reviewed) is:
> [8308815](https://bugs.openjdk.org/browse/JDK-8308815): extend `SetLocalXXX` minimal support for virtual threads
This is spec only fix without any update in implementation.
There is one approval from Chris and another approval from Alan on the CSR.
